Hi all,

Just a quick question, when doing a routine rebuild going .5mm over is it needed to replace the wrist pin bearing every time or can the old be used? I know it's only fifteen bucks but I would have to wait another week for the part to show up since they have none local in our small town.

Brian

Posted: January 29th, 2012, 11:09 am
by AlisoBob
I reused them before.... never a issue.

Inspect it closely...

I've never reused the clips however...


:nono:

Posted: January 29th, 2012, 8:12 pm
by 2strokeforever
im kinda sketched about circlips, i always install the gap up or down and they almost never come out that way :shock:

re used many wristpin bearings, never a problem
